Domestic Violence Awareness Fair to be Held October 14

The County of Maui Committee on the Status of Women announced it is hosting its 4th Annual Domestic Violence Awareness Fair on Saturday, Oct. 14, 2017 from 11 a.m. – 3 p.m. at Queen Kaahumanu Center.

The event is open to the public and is designed to provide information about domestic violence and the support and resources available to our community. Participating organizations include Women Helping Women, PACT (Parents And Children Together), Child & Family Services, the Office of the Prosecuting Attorney – Victim Witness Program, and Maui Police Department’s Domestic Violence Unit.

“It’s up to us as a community to help stop domestic violence,” said Sheila Rae Kelley, Chair of the Committee on the Status of Women. “Our hope is that this event can offer hope and healing to anyone needing help in saying ‘No More’ to an abusive situation. We all need to be educated about the impacts as well as the resources that are available,because in truth, domestic violence affects all of our lives.”

ABOUT THE FILM:  
The BFG is a 2016 American fantasy adventure film based on the 1982 novel by Roald Dahl. It was directed by Steven Spielberg and written by Melissa Mathison. In the film, ten-year-old orphan, Sophie, befriends a benevolent big friendly giant and is in for the adventure of a lifetime. Naturally scared at first, the young girl soon realizes that the 24-foot behemoth is actually quite gentle and charming. As their friendship grows, Sophie’s presence attracts the unwanted attention of Bloodbottler, Fleshlumpeater, and other giants as they travel to Giant Country. Sophie and the BFG must convince Queen Victoria to help them stop all the bad giants invading the human world once and for all.

Evening Chore Tour

3651 Omaopio Rd., Kula

On going event

Monday – Saturday, 3:15 – 4:15 PM.

All age levels are appropriate

Assist in our evening chores. Learn to hand milk a goat, then help with the evening feedings and learn more about our award winning cheeses and how they are made. $12 for kids $15 for adult
